It’s important to understand that when you purchase this turn-key unit, you are primarily buying the structure and its integrated systems. The delivery typically includes the fully assembled two-story container module, complete with its welded steel frame, insulated walls, roof, and flooring. Pre-installed elements include the electrical conduit and breaker panel, plumbing P-traps and drain lines, and the staircase or ladder access to the rooftop. Doors and windows are installed, and basic interior wall cladding (often marine-grade plywood or moisture-resistant drywall) is in place. You will not receive commercial kitchen equipment (espresso machines, griddles, fridges), furniture, POS systems, or decorative elements unless specifically negotiated as part of a custom package. The unit arrives “weathertight and secure,” ready for final utility connections and your fit-out. Step 1: Site Preparation and Delivery

Before your unit arrives, you must secure a level site with proper access for a large truck and crane. Prepare a stable foundation—this can be concrete piers, a compacted gravel pad, or a concrete slab. Coordinate closely with the manufacturer and transport company. Upon delivery, the unit will be craned onto your foundation. This is the moment the promise of a rapid-deployment solution to buy 2 story shipping container restaurant becomes real.

Step 2: Utility Connection and Hookup

This is the most technical phase. A licensed electrician and plumber must connect the unit’s pre-run lines to your site’s mains. This involves hooking up to power (often requiring a 200-amp service), water supply, and sewer or a designated greywater/blackwater tank system. Proper grounding and utility certification are essential for safety and compliance.

Step 3: Interior Fit-Out and Branding

Now comes the customization. Install your commercial kitchen equipment, ensuring it’s properly vented. Build out your service counter, install refrigeration, and set up your POS. On the rooftop, arrange furniture, lighting, and any shade structures. Apply your final brand colors, signage, and graphics. This step transforms the shell into your unique business.

Step 4: Licensing, Inspection, and Opening

You must schedule and pass all local health department, fire safety, and building code inspections. The modular nature can streamline this, as many systems are pre-approved. Once licensed, stock inventory, train staff, and you’re ready for your grand opening—potentially just weeks after delivery, a key advantage when you should I buy a container restaurant for speed-to-market.

Step 5: Daily Operations and Mobility

Operate it like any other restaurant. The insulated walls maintain temperature efficiently. If you need to relocate, the process is essentially reversed: disconnect utilities, hire a crane and truck, and move to the new site. This mobility is a core benefit in the container restaurant vs traditional build comparison.

Step 6: Maintenance and Care

Regular maintenance is simple. Inspect the exterior paint and sealants annually for wear. Keep roof drains clear of debris. Check door and window seals. Expert Tips for Maximum Value

Tip #1: Master Your Site Logistics First

Before you buy, have a specific site (or multiple sites) in mind. Confirm zoning, utility access points, and crane truck accessibility. A great site is more important than the unit itself.

Tip #2: Invest in Professional Kitchen Design

Hire a consultant familiar with compact kitchens. Every inch counts. A smart workflow layout will boost your efficiency and staff morale more than any other upgrade.

Tip #3: Prioritize Climate Control

Even with good insulation, invest in a high-quality, correctly sized HVAC system for both floors. A comfortable environment keeps customers staying longer and staff productive. For reliable equipment, consider bundled climate control solutions.

Tip #4: Plan for Multiple Power Sources

For true mobility at off-grid events, design in a hookup for a quiet, high-capacity generator or solar/battery system from the start.

Tip #5: Use the Rooftop Creatively

Don’t just add chairs. Consider green walls, retractable awnings, fire pits, or projector screens for movies. Make it an experience that people photograph and share.

Tip #6: Build a Relocation Fund

Set aside $3k-$5k from your profits specifically for future moving costs. This ensures you can actually leverage the mobility you paid for when opportunity calls.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Mistake: Underestimating total project cost. → Solution: Create a detailed budget that includes the unit, delivery, site work, utilities, interior fit-out, equipment, permits, and a 20% contingency fund.
  2. Mistake: Choosing a site without due diligence. → Solution: Get written confirmation from the landlord and local municipality that your use is permitted before signing any contracts or purchasing the unit.
  3. Mistake: Poor kitchen ventilation planning. → Solution: Work with an HVAC expert to install a powerful, code-compliant exhaust hood. Poor ventilation will ruin the customer experience on the rooftop.
  4. Mistake: Neglecting the foundation. → Solution: Never place it directly on dirt. A proper, level foundation (concrete piers or slab) is critical for stability, door operation, and plumbing.
  5. Mistake: Forgetting about accessibility. → Solution: If required by law or your target market, plan for a ramp or lift to the main service counter or consider a single-story model for full accessibility.

How difficult is it to get permits for one of these?

Difficulty varies wildly by city and county. Some municipalities have embraced modular structures and have clear guidelines, while others may be hesitant. The key is to approach the planning department early with detailed plans, emphasizing its temporary foundation and compliance with building codes. Hiring a local expediter can be a worthwhile investment.

Can I really move it after it’s set up?

Yes, that’s a core feature. However, moving it requires planning and cost ($2k-$5k per move). You’ll need to disconnect utilities, hire a crane and flatbed truck, and then re-do the site prep and connections at the new location. It’s designed for mobility, but it’s not as simple as driving a food truck away.
